Pacific Mills Cotton Mill Records

 Collection
Identifier: 6825/001
Abstract Records include correspondence and memoranda, 1854-1889, concerning contracts, construction and purchases; also letters from English operatives re the conditions of their employment at Pacific Mills, 1862-1866; orders for English machinery by William C. Chapin, Agt., 1862; tax bills & receipts; construction memorandum, 1873. Also includes one spinning time book, 1879-1881; name in flyleaf, "Mr. John Barker, W Spinning, Pacific Mills, Lawrence." Also assignment of patent rights, 1876,...
Dates: 1854-1889

Pemberton Mill Relief Committee Records

 Collection — Multiple Containers
Identifier: 6831
Abstract

Collection includes meeting minutes, survey of relief needs, city canvasser's report, detailed ward inspectors' and physicians' reports and correspondence. Financial records include account books listing amount spent per employee, cash received, check registers, vouchers and index to cash vouchers. Also copy of Robert H. Tewksbury's "Historical Sketch: The Fall of the Pemberton Mill," published in 1900.
